Job Summary

The Director, Product Management is a key leadership position in our Product organization.  This role provides active direction to a high performing team of Product managers to achieve the best experience for our IDE, Drivers & Clients. 

Define and drive the IDE Vision & strategy for Teradata

  • Create an IDE strategy and plan for Teradata
  • Manage Vantage Editor & 3rd Party IDE Extensions
  • IDE Partner relationships
  • Evangelize the strategy and partner with marketing for field enablement

Drive the client tools & driver strategy

  • Define a unified & cohesive vision for CLI & execute on it
  • Manage the drivers portfolio including distribution considerations
  • Closely partner with the developer advocacy team to ensure a cohesive experience

Be a strategic partner for cloud native integrations

  • Work with AWS Azure, Google Cloud on building connectivity to strategic Cloud native services
  • Build business cases for making Vantage to be a first party sink for cloud native services
  • Negotiate and enable a marketplace presence for the drivers to drive adoption

In this role, you'll be a leader in developing our IDE, ClI & Cloud native partner strategy using action-oriented data-driven decision-making processes.  The role requires a candidate with strong analytical skills using data-driven approach(es) and a passion for driving business results. This role will include significant interaction with our customers, finance, operations, go-to-market sales, marketing, and cross-functional product teams. 

  • Engage with customers and prospects to define broader market requirements and feed that into the product portfolio to refine the portfolio and rationalize priorities 
  • Monitor market trends and bridge business gaps by authoring technical requirements for the scrum team.
  • Engage with customers and key stakeholders on an ongoing basis to validate existing product requirements and evolve as needed
  • Manage prioritization and trade-offs among customer experience, performance, and operational support load.
  • Develop pricing strategies and monitor trends for new products and services.
  • Ensure the delivery of committed roadmap “Epics” measured by objectively defined KPI’s.
  • Manage products through various launch phases and follow-on releases.
  • Collaborate with other Product Managers across dependent Agile teams.
  • Promote sale of company products requiring extensive technical expertise.
  • Plan, direct, or coordinate marketing policies and programs.
  • Define and drive the business plan, strategy, and positioning of the services and solutions and work with internal and external partners to enable integration.
  • Work closely with Product Marketing, Support, Professional Services, Sales, and Operations to define the go to market plan and product collateral.
